Pre Season bass in Outaouais / Ottawa River
After catching the nice bass in the St. Lawrence river the previous day, we decided on a last minute/ spur of the moment ½ day trip to the Outaouais / Ottawa river as I figured the bass should be on their way in to spawn. We used 4 inch shiners with pike rigs under bobbers for this one. As I know my spot, we used the bobber to drift the bait over the intended "strike zone" with deadly results. Within 20 minutes I caught 2 bass in the 3.5 LB range. The days ended with 3 more bass in the 2 - 2.5 LB range, all on the same rig, using the same bait, over the same spot. All fish were live released as the season on the river is closed until mid June.
